If you are unable to connect your Sciwheel / Lean Library Workspace account using OpenAthens, or OpenAthens authentication previously worked but has recently stopped working, this may be related to the migration from Sciwheel to Lean Library Workspace.
This article explains what changed and what you or your OpenAthens administrator should check.
Why has my Sciwheel OpenAthens access stopped working?
On 6 July 2026, Sciwheel migrated from Sage to Lean Library. As part of this change, the OpenAthens resource previously known as Sciwheel was replaced by the new Lean Library Workspace resource.
OpenAthens advised existing Sciwheel customers that it would migrate organisations to the new Lean Library Workspace resource, including allocating the new resource to their OpenAthens catalogue and permission sets.
No action should normally have been required from institutions for this part of the migration.
However, institutions that were using older Sciwheel WAYFless links may need to update those links. If OpenAthens authentication is not working, it is also worth confirming that the resource migration was completed successfully for your organisation.
1. Confirm that Lean Library Workspace was migrated successfully in OpenAthens
As part of the migration from Sciwheel to Lean Library Workspace, OpenAthens advised existing customers that it would allocate the new Lean Library Workspace resource to their catalogue and permission sets.
If OpenAthens authentication is not working, we recommend asking your OpenAthens administrator to confirm that this migration was completed successfully for your organisation.
Please check that:
- Lean Library Workspace appears in your institution's OpenAthens catalogue.
- The resource has been allocated to the appropriate permission sets.
- Where applicable, the affected users are associated with the relevant permission sets
If Lean Library Workspace is missing from your OpenAthens catalogue or has not been allocated correctly, please contact your OpenAthens support provider, as OpenAthens was responsible for this part of the migration.
2. Check whether your institution is using an old Sciwheel WAYFless link
Some institutions previously provided users with a Sciwheel OpenAthens WAYFless link beginning with:
https://sciwheel.com/openathens/wayfless?entity=...
OpenAthens advised customers using these links that they needed to be updated following the migration on 6 July 2026.
If your institution provides users with a WAYFless link to access Sciwheel, an older Sciwheel WAYFless link may no longer work correctly following the migration.
If you normally access Sciwheel by signing in directly and selecting OpenAthens/Shibboleth from within your account, this step may not apply to you.
3. Replace legacy WAYFless links with an OpenAthens Redirector link
OpenAthens recommends using an OpenAthens Redirector link instead of the older Sciwheel WAYFless links.
OpenAthens Redirector links normally begin with:
https://go.openathens.net/...
Your OpenAthens administrator can generate the appropriate Redirector link using the OpenAthens Redirector Link Generator.
If your institution was already using a Redirector link beginning with go.openathens.net, OpenAthens advised that you do not need to update that link as part of this migration.
4. Try connecting your Lean Library Workspace account again
Once your institution has confirmed the OpenAthens configuration:
- Sign in to your Sciwheel / Lean Library Workspace account.
- Open your account or subscription settings.
- Select OpenAthens/Shibboleth as the authentication method.
- Search for and select your institution.
- Complete your institution's OpenAthens sign-in process.
If authentication still does not complete successfully, try again in a private or incognito browser window.
You may also need to temporarily allow third-party cookies, as browser privacy settings can sometimes interfere with authentication redirects.
Still unable to connect Sciwheel or Lean Library Workspace to OpenAthens?
If your OpenAthens administrator has confirmed that:
- Lean Library Workspace is available in your OpenAthens catalogue.
- The resource is allocated to the correct permission sets.
- The affected users have access through those permission sets.
- Any legacy Sciwheel WAYFless links have been replaced where applicable.
- You are using an OpenAthens Redirector link where required.
and authentication is still not working; please contact Lean Library Support.
When contacting us, please include:
- Your institution's name.
- A screenshot showing the complete error message or page you see.
- Confirmation of whether other users at your institution experience the same issue.
- Confirmation that your OpenAthens administrator has checked the Lean Library Workspace resource and permission settings.
- Your institution's OpenAthens Entity ID, OpenAthens ID or Scope, if available.
We can then check your institution's Lean Library Workspace configuration and investigate the OpenAthens authentication issue further.
